Select element by name javascript Syntax: [name="nameOfElement"]. log(sizes); Code language: JavaScript Sets or returns the value of the name attribute of a drop-down list: selectedIndex: Sets or returns the index of the selected option in a drop-down list: size: Sets or returns the value of the size of a drop-down list: type: Returns which type of form element a drop-down list is: value: Sets or returns the value of the selected option in a drop W3Schools offers free online tutorials, references and exercises in all the major languages of the web. The length Property returns the number of elements in the collection. # Get Element(s) by Partially matching their Name attribute. each() method to traverse all Summary: in this tutorial, you will learn how to handle the <select> element in JavaScript. value); console. Sep 28, 2010 · If you want to provide support for older browsers, you could load a stand-alone selector engine like Sizzle (4KB mini+gzip) or Peppy (10K mini) and fall back to it if the native querySelector method is not found. We know all form elements need names, even before they get ids. querySelector() wouldn't find. There are two methods to solve this problem which are discusses below: Approach 1: First select all elements using $('*') selector, which selects every element of the document. Finding HTML Elements. To create a <select> element, you use the <select> and <option> elements. myclass' Dec 30, 2016 · Can you please tell me if there is any DOM API which search for an element with given attribute name and attribute value: Something like: doc. Assuming that your desired element is in results index 0 ([0]) is usually safe, but better to check and be sure. Also, while the name attribute is sometimes all that is available, do try to use id where possible as they have more chance of being unique. To get an element by partially matching its name attribute, use the querySelector method with a selector that matches a name attribute whose value starts with, ends with or contains a specific string. map. Sep 17, 2024 · Using the name selector Method. Apr 5, 2024 · Given a HTML document and the task is to get the all ID of the DOM elements in an array. Note that this method name specifies “Elements” plural. Mar 5, 2024 · The example would only match a div element that has a name attribute set to box1. getElementById() to return a reference to an element by its unique id; document. As I mentioned at the start getElementsByClassName() is one of those selectors that will return an array-like list, in this case an HTML collection. For a few lines of code (with some logging perhaps) you save your end users the problems of W3Schools offers free online tutorials, references and exercises in all the major languages of the web. getElementsByTagName() to return references to elements with the same tag name; document. namedItem() is the only API you should use, because input elements can exist outside <form> as well, which form. The elements can be accessed by index (starts at 0). To get all elements with a specified name, you use the getElementsByName() method of the document object: let elements = document. The name selector method in jQuery uses the [name=”nameOfElement”] syntax to select elements based on their name attribute. The following example uses the getElementsByName() method to select the radio button and returns the list of values: let elems = document. Is it overkill to load a selector engine just so you can get elements with a certain class? Probably. Introduction to the HTML select elements A <select> element provides you with a list of options. To do so, you have to find the elements first. An HTMLCollection is an array-like collection (list) of HTML elements. An HTMLCollection is live. querySelector() to return references to elements via CSS selectors like 'div. call(elems,elem => elem. A <select> element allows you to select one or multiple options. It is automatically updated when the document is changed. findElementByAttribute("myAttribute", "aValue"); Mar 5, 2024 · The example would only match a div element that has a name attribute set to box1. Note 2: . To select elements by the name attribute, you use the getElementsByName() method. Jul 7, 2023 · document. Use . For […] Jan 13, 2020 · Much like our buddy getElementById(), this method will retrieve all elements with the given class name. Often, with JavaScript, you want to manipulate HTML elements. elements. Jul 24, 2022 · Beginners are likely to want to access values from a select with the NAME attribute rather than ID attribute. Jan 13, 2020 · Much like our buddy getElementById(), this method will retrieve all elements with the given class name. getElementsByName(name); Code language: JavaScript (javascript) The getElementsByName() accepts a name which is the value of the name attribute of elements and returns a live NodeList of elements. This method precisely targets elements with matching names, making it ideal for form elements like inputs and radio buttons that share a common name.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. There are several ways to do this: Finding HTML elements by id; Finding HTML elements by tag name ; Finding HTML elements by class name; Finding HTML elements by CSS selectors; Finding HTML elements by HTML object Note: if multiple elements have the same name attribute (for example radio and checkbox lists), it will return a list of elements, not a single element. getElementsByName('size'); let sizes = []. fuqh bthlc tkobfl idi flaraa hgltlxp qwve fnzea ardh bdddgi zocuusj lcgd tiuyl yfynz blvuw